The Mournpost bounce processor exposes a single ingestion endpoint that accepts batched bounce events from the Larkspindle mail relay. On-call engineers should note that hard bounces are quarantined immediately, while soft bounces are retried on an exponential schedule capped at six attempts. All requests must be authenticated; unauthenticated calls are dropped silently, which can look like data loss. When replaying stuck batches manually, authenticate your requests with the internal key below.

service key, fawip-bajef: kto11_Qt5wZK9vdNC

## v3.2.0 — Changed defaults

Heads up: we've tightened the defaults for Wavelet, the audio waveform preview service. Previews are now rendered server-side only, the upload size cap dropped, and anonymous preview URLs expire much faster. This closes the loophole from the Q2 review where stale preview links lingered indefinitely. Nothing else changed behaviorally, but since these defaults are security-relevant we'd like a second pair of eyes. The new default configuration ships as follows.

settings of fafog-haduf:
ZORIX_PIN=4648
ZORIX_METRICS_HOST=metrics.zorix.paliqsys.corp
ZORIX_LOG_LEVEL=info
ZORIX_TENANT=druix

Quarterly Planning Note — Divestiture of the Coastal Tooling Unit

For the finance team: the sale of the Coastal Tooling unit to Pellmark Industries remains on track for close in Q3. Please finalize the carve-out balance sheet, reconcile intercompany positions, and prepare the working-capital adjustment schedule by month-end. Audit support requests should be prioritized. For planning purposes, note the following sensitive item:

internal memo for hawef-kahif: The finance team signed off on a budget of $25.9 million for Project Sorox. The renewal with Pelokek Logistics closes at $51.7 million a year, 52 percent below the last contract.